They say that moving house is one of the most stressful things that you can do. In fact, two-thirds of people rated it as the most stressful thing you could do above relationship breakdowns and starting a new job in a poll.

But there are ways of planning a move so that it is less stressful. From packing for a move through to the actual process of moving itself, it’s possible to lighten the load considerably.

We’ll share some moving tips to help make the whole moving process much easier in this guide.

image - 7 Moving Tips That'll Make the Process Easier
7 Moving Tips That’ll Make the Process Easier

1. Stock Up On Moving Supplies

If you or anyone you know works in a shop, see whether you can get leftover boxes from deliveries.

Don’t forget to stock up on tape. You’ll need plenty of roles of parcel tape to seal all of your boxes.

2. Start Packing Early

Never underestimate how long it’ll take to pack ready for a move. You should start packing at least a couple of weeks before your move.

Start by picking up things that you won’t use or need before your move.

3. Use Up All of Your Groceries

If you’re moving to another state, you’ll not want to cart fresh groceries with you. Plan to use up all of your groceries before your move.

You can do this by carefully considering what meals you’ll be eating on the run-up to your moving date.

4. Declutter as You Go

As you pack up your possessions, look for things you can either throw away, give to charity, or sell.

Decluttering will mean there will be less to move and less to unpack when you get to your new home.

5. Use a Storage Container

There are lots of reasons to hire a storage container to help you with the moving process. For example, if you’re selling the home you live in, you may need to declutter to let potential buyers view the house.

6. Hire a Moving Company

If you want to really take the stress out of your move, you should consider hiring a removals company to come and help you with your move.

Having a team of professionals on hand will make the job much easier for you and lighten your load.

7. Organize as You Pack

As you’re packing, think about where your items will go in your new home. Box them all together and label up the boxes according to which room they will go in.

Keep similar items together. You may even want to color-code your boxes by room to make things quicker and easier to sort when unloading your removals van.

Moving Tips That’ll Make the Process Easier

Packing for a move needn’t be the most stressful thing in the world. If you follow these moving tips, you’ll be able to move in a relatively stress-free fashion.
